A subset of content validity is face validity, where experts are asked their opinion about whether an instrument measures the concept intended.Ĭonstruct validity refers to whether you can draw inferences about test scores related to the concept being studied. In other words, does the instrument cover the entire domain related to the variable, or construct it was designed to measure? In an undergraduate nursing course with instruction about public health, an examination with content validity would cover all the content in the course with greater emphasis on the topics that had received greater coverage or more depth.
